Manuscript evaluators are professionals or experts who review, assess, and provide feedback on written work, such as research papers, manuscripts, or articles.
Key Features
- Expertise in the field
- Ability to provide constructive feedback
- Knowledge of academic standards and publishing guidelines
Pros
- Helps authors improve the quality of their work
- Provides valuable insights and recommendations for manuscript enhancement
- Assists in ensuring compliance with academic standards and publication requirements
Cons
- Costly service for some authors
- Subjectivity in evaluation criteria may vary across evaluators
